Pine Pellets: Can you use pine pellets for cat litter

Pine litter is safe for cats, as long as the pellets or shavings are kiln dried to remove a majority of phenol and contain no potentially

harmful additives

Because pine litter is made from natural wood fiber, pine pellets and pine shavings are also safe for kittens and cats who are prone to infection.

Pine Pellet Litter: How often should you sift pine pellet litter

Wood and pine pellet litter should be cleaned daily. Sift sawdust at least once a day and

scoop solids

as soon as possible after use. With a consistent cleaning routine, pellet litter should only need to be changed about once every four weeks.

Crystals Cat Litter: What is crystals cat litter

Crystal cat litter is made from silica gel, an absorbent material that helps trap moisture and odors Unlike some other types of litter, this one doesn’t clump so you’ll need to change out the whole pan of litter on a regular basis to prevent odors from forming.

Pine Litter: Does pine litter attract bugs

Pine cat litter can attract certain bugs, like earwigs, house centipedes, and roaches But the litter itself is rarely the cause of the infestation. Rather, it just draws insects to a more visible location, instead of behind walls, under sinks, or in basements where they would normally stay.

Pine Pellet Litter: How do you dispose of pine pellet litter

Composting is the best method of disposing of wood and pine pellet cat litter If that’s not something you want to or are able to do, litter should be bagged and sent to the landfill. Dumping and flushing used cat litter is not recommended.

Cat Pee: Do you scoop cat pee

Clumping litters need changing less frequently because you can use a litter scoop to remove the coated clumps of cat pee and poop Non-clumping litters cannot be scooped, so to clean them you must change out all of the litter each time.
